Former Director of Prisons, Welton Trotz was on Wednesday elated when Magistrate Fabayo Azore found him not guilty of a sexual assault charge brought against him.

Trotz appeared at the Georgetown Magistrates’ Courts, and heard his fate in a private session.

The case which alleged that Trotz sexually assaulted a female Prison Officer was first brought before the court in October 2015.

In court on Wednesday, the Magistrate ruled that there was insufficient evidence to prove the allegation and, as such, dismissed the case.

With a huge smile, Trotz walked out of the courtroom and in a brief interview with the media, he related that he was happy that the charges were dismissed and thanked the judicial system in Guyana for its fairness.

He relayed that he was not guilty of the offence and was sure that the truth of the matter would be uncovered.

“Even if they ask me to resume my former position, I would say no because how can you work amongst people who do not trust you,” he told the media.

In 2015, Trotz was slapped with the charge after Public Security Minister Khemraj Ramjattan relieved him of his position following an investigation into the incident.
